Virginia Beach, VA — June 10, 2025 — SheepFeast, a discipleship-focused tech and training platform, has officially launched 1 Million Discipled, a global movement aimed at equipping and empowering one million disciples through technology, training, and community.
At the heart of the initiative is the question: “Are you one?”—an invitation for believers to take their place in a mission-driven community committed to multiplying disciples locally and globally.

“SheepFeast was created to help leaders feed, lead, and tend their flocks with simplicity and purpose,” said founder Mark Rowan. “With 1 Million Discipled, we’re combining meaningful giving with tangible spiritual and practical tools that help people walk out their calling.”
Participants are encouraged to share their involvement by declaring “I Am One”—a statement of unity with Christ, the Church, and the global mission. The campaign draws from key biblical themes, including Romans 6:5–7, 1 Corinthians 12, and Matthew 18:12.
The movement was officially introduced during SheepFeast’s live Corral Call on YouTube and continues to grow through partnerships with leaders, churches, and kingdom-minded entrepreneurs worldwide.

About SheepFeast
SheepFeast is a discipleship communications and technology platform helping Christian leaders make disciples of all nations. Through its digital platform, The Farmwork, and community initiatives like The 70 and The 12, SheepFeast equips pastors, entrepreneurs, and ministries with tools to disciple effectively and sustainably.
